About the role
MacKillop Catholic College, Mount Peter is seeking applications for a Student Learning Assistant - Student Engagement to join their Primary team.
Commencement Date: Term 4, Tuesday 6th October 2026 (earlier start date will be considered)
Salary Range: SOF Level 4 $36.98 - $38.14 gross per hour
Employment Type: Term-Time, Permanent Position | 32 hours per week
Closing Date for Applications: 12.00pm, Friday 11th September 2026 (unless filled prior)
MacKillop Catholic College, Mount PeterMacKillop Catholic College, a master-planned Prep to Year 12 College located in the growing southern corridor of Cairns, was established in 2016 with Prep-Year 3 classes. The College has developed progressively, adding additional year levels annually, and commenced secondary education in 2020 with Year 7, and the first Year 12 cohort graduating in 2025. Guided by the authentic discipleship of Saint Mary MacKillop of the Cross, and the Josephite tradition, our mission, to inspire hearts, minds and spirits, is grounded in the vision to provide quality 21st century education to the young people in our community.
About the RoleThe School Learning Officer - Student Engagement's role is specifically to support student engagement in learning. This will include assisting students to regulate their emotions, responding to student escalations and exploring challenges that impact students' abilities to engage across learning environments. This assistance may also extend to planning and resourcing interventions for students, delivered by the School Learning Officer - Student Engagement and/or other staff members. This position works under the supervision of the Deputy Principal - Head of Primary.
